A natural ecosystem is self-sustaining and dynamically balanced, with minimal human intervention, while a managed ecosystem is actively controlled by humans to achieve specific goals such as increased productivity or biodiversity. Natural ecosystems evolve over time based on natural processes and interactions, whereas managed ecosystems are subject to intentional interventions like planting, harvesting, or removal of species to achieve desired outcomes.
There is no ecosystem that is truly maintenance-free, as all ecosystems require some level of natural processes and interactions to remain in balance. However, mature and stable ecosystems that are left undisturbed by human activity often require less external intervention compared to ecosystems that have been altered or disrupted.
